Restaurants in Lexington, MA
Restaurants • Ice Cream & Frozen Yogurt • Sweets
1060 Waltham St.,
Lexington ,
MA
02421
UNITED STATES
Worldwide > United States > Lexington, MA > Ice Cream & Frozen Yogurt